Transaction 173048e28454a289d4fbad03f82ea93c361de22dbf4661191f345fbf25a7b679
1 Input
1 Output
-
173048e28454a289d4fbad03f82ea93c361de22dbf4661191f345fbf25a7b679:0
- value
- 39718150
- script pubkey
- OP_0 OP_PUSHBYTES_20 5753a52f77c2aafbc74f9d7bc9f97d9302583ddc
- address
- bc1q2af62tmhc240h360n4aun7tajvp9s0wung8gpq